![]() Mixed prices in aromatics10:56 AM MST | January 2, 2013 | Lindsay Frost In aromatics, spot benzene on the US Gulf ticked higher by 5 cts/gal, but mixed xylenes were reported lower in a narrowing trading range as buyers reduced bids by 5 cts/gal and sellers chased them down by 15 cts/gal on offers. Styrene, responding to production outages, rose 3 cts/lb. In Europe, the only movers were benzene and styrene, traders report. Benzene spiked $30/m.t. while styrene soared $80/m.t.
